Explain the difference between a watch and a warning.

Something like this:

Watches usually cover a large area where severe weather conditions could develop. A warning happens when conditions are already occurring or will be soon.

This is a widespread, long-lived wind storm that is associated with a band of rapidly moving showers or thunderstorms. 

What is a derecho?

Explain CAPE to me.

Convective Available Potential Energy is the amount of fuel available to a developing thunderstorm. More specifically, it describes the instability of the atmosphere and provides an approximation of updraft strength within a thunderstorm.

This is ghostly precipitation that never makes it to the ground. When the air beneath a cloud is very dry, precipitation falling through it evaporates before reaching Earth’s surface. 

What is virga?
